Cantai, ora piango

’Cantai, ora piango’ is a piece for clarinet, cello, percussion, indian harmonium and chord zither. It is written for the ensemble Mimitabu to be played at Spor-festival 2014.



The title is Italian and means ’I sang, now I am crying’. It is a line from a famous poem by the renaissance poet Francesco Petrarca.
